Three Killed in High-Speed Car Collision with Parked Truck on Jalandhar Highway
Three youths died when their speeding Maruti Swift car collided with a stationary tipper truck on the Jalandhar-Amritsar highway near Maqsudan early Saturday morning. The impact severely mangled the car, trapping two occupants and ejecting a third, all of whom died at the scene. The truck driver fled but is being traced by police. The car's registration links to Lamma Pind area, and investigations are ongoing. Separately, another accident in Sirhind killed three Kanwariyas and injured one.
